Avalon Waterways Welcomes Irish Agents Onboard as part of Fam Trip Programme

Avalon Waterways has successfully hosted Irish travel agents onboard as part of its ongoing commitment to trade engagement, giving partners the opportunity to experience the river cruise product first-hand. The fam trip at the end of November welcomed invited agents to join Avalon Waterways’ ‘Romantic Rhine for Wine Lovers’ itinerary. Agents enjoyed a three-night sailing from Rüdesheim to Amsterdam onboard Avalon View, staying in the line’s signature Panorama Suites. The trip was hosted by Jo-Ann Raleigh and Alan Sparling from ASM Ireland who represent Avalon Waterways in the Irish market.

Agents onboard included store managers, senior travel consultants and cruise specialists from leading Irish agencies. Throughout the sailing, agents were able to explore the Avalon experience both onboard and ashore, with a range of excursions available to showcase the style, flexibility, and immersive nature of Avalon’s itineraries. Highlights included time to explore the Christmas markets of Koblenz, a walking tour of Cologne, Gala Dinner and a guided canal cruise through Amsterdam.

Avalon is renowned for its elevated cruising experience and the exceptional views offered onboard. No other river cruise fleet features the award-winning Avalon Panorama Suites (SM), which are 30% larger than the industry standard and offer river cruising’s only Open-Air Balcony, allowing guests to enjoy the sights and sounds of the river with uninterrupted panoramic views. Avalon’s cabin layout is also designed so that beds face outward towards the floor-to-ceiling windows, ensuring guests wake up to a new view each morning.

Avalon Waterways’ river cruises include a wide range of inclusions as standard, such as full-board dining, complimentary regional wine or beer at mealtimes, soft drinks, daily happy hour with complimentary drinks, included excursions, and gratuities. Onboard dining options range from four-course chef-designed menus in the main dining room with flexible mealtimes, to more informal dining for light bites, and the Sky Grill on the top deck for outdoor barbecues in a memorable open-air setting.
